Centre County, PA District Attorney Stacy Parks Miller discusses the latest development in her prosecution of 18 students and a fraternity for the February 2017 hazing death of sophomore Timothy Piazza. On September 1, 2017, a judge dismissed the most serious charges including involuntary manslaughter. The DA first spoke to Karas on Crime in May 2017 after the charges were announced.
